WebThese branches will form the central frame- work of the tree and should grow at a wide angle from the leader. At plantingIf you plant an unbranched whip tree, cut off the top leaving the tree 30–45 inches tall. Side branches will grow from the whip the first year. New branches will grow just below this cut.
